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Assessment

Water damage can be sneaky, it might not be immediately apparent, but it can still cause significant probl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to watch out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can be a sign of hidden moisture. If you notice a musty smell in your basement or crawl space, it’s time to investigate.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Water damage can cause floors to warp or discolor. If you notice any unusual changes in your flooring, it’s a good idea to have it inspected.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ice any water marks or discoloration on your ceilings or walls, it’s time to call in the experts.

Increased Humidity

High humidity can be a sign of water damage. If you notice a sudden increase in humidity in your home, it’s a good idea to investigate further.

Leaks or Water Damage in Hidden Areas

Leaks or water damage in hidden areas, such as behind walls or under flooring, can be particularly problematic. If you suspect a leak or water damage in a hidden area, don’t hesitate to call in the experts.

Unusual Noises

Unusual noises, such as creaking or groaning, can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any unusual sounds coming from your walls or floors, it’s a good idea to investigate further.

Water Damage Assessment v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om Yes No DIY fixes are usually enough for small leaks.
Water damage in a large area No Yes Large areas of water damage need spec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.
Hidden moisture in walls or floors No Yes Hidden moisture can be difficult to detect and need specialized equipment to identify and address.
Water damage in a sensitive area, such as a kitchen or bathroom No Yes Water damage in sensitive areas needs specialized care and attention to prevent further damage and ensure safe and healthy living conditions.
Water damage caused by a natural disaster, such as a flood No Yes Natural disasters often need spec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.
